After losing to Cartersville the last time they met, Dalton decided to demonstrate that turnabout is fair play. The Dalton Catamounts walked away with  a   55-45  victory over the Cartersville Hurricanes  on Thursday.
 Several Hurricanes players turned in solid performances despite ultimately coming up short. Perhaps the best among those players was   Nas Bennett, who  posted 17 points and five  rebounds. Another player making a difference was  Wyatt Thomason, who  dropped  a double-double with ten  points and 11  boards.
Dalton's win bumped their record up to 15-11. As for Cartersville, their loss dropped their record down to 16-11.
 Dalton has  already played their next  game (against Allatoona), but no score has been uploaded at the time of writing. As for Cartersville, they wasted no time getting back out on the court and have already played their next  matchup,  a  66-59  victory against Cedartown on the 14th.
